At the Dr. Yum Project, we empower families and communities to overcome barriers to healthy eating with practical, evidence-based programs with a positive, developmental approach to feeding and nutrition. Founded by a pediatrician and designed by experts in child development, feeding therapy, and nutrition, we help kids build the lifelong skill of enjoying nourishing foods. How We Achieve Impact: Dr. Yum’s Food Adventure Our innovative, evidence-based curriculum, used in schools across 41 states and three countries, integrates child development principles and feeding therapy techniques into food education for 3 to 8-year-olds to reframe the picky eating paradigm. By helping all children, regardless of background or ability, to "practice" and enjoy nourishing foods, we increase healthy food consumption and reduce food waste both at school and at home. This scalable, multigenerational model helps create more equitable access to foundational good nutrition while fostering wellness, environmental stewardship, and a more nourished future for all children. Touchpoints Our customizable program of health behavior modules that pediatricians can offer to patients right in their office. It is family-centered, weight-neutral, and billable. Dr. Yum Physican Partners are in 32 states. Technology Tools Our website, DoctorYum.org is an ecosystem of free nutrition information for families, kids, teachers, and physicians. Highlights include our recipe catalog of over 220 recipes. Tools like Dr. Yum's Meal-o-Matic allow users to make a custom recipe with foods available at home. We feature blogs and articles written by a variety of experts and printable downloads for families, physicians & food distribution sites in English & Spanish. We are proud to be a Council Member of Tufts University’s Food and Nutrition Innovation Council and a founding member of the Partnership for a Healthier America’s “Veggies Early and Often” campaign, advancing child nutrition on a national scale.
